SummaryStudents will apply the knowledge gained from the taught courses, as well as their research review, to an intellectually demanding research topic chosen by themselves under the guidance of a supervisor. They will perform this research project either independently or in small groups, with only the minimal of practical supervision necessary to meet their project?s broad aim and objectives.

Learning Outcomes
The students will learn to use available equipment, facilities and research resources innovatively to produce new knowledge or practical procedures that address their chosen research topic. They will also learn how to plan and meet project milestones, as well as the necessary presentational skills required to produce a dissertation and to verbally describe their project achievements to others.
